Weather Overview in Guayaquil
Guayaquil features a tropical monsoon climate with consistent warmth. Annual average temperature is 26°C (79°F), with highs of 31°C (88°F) and lows of 22°C (72°F). Humidity averages 80%, making it feel hotter. Precipitation totals about 2,000 mm yearly, mostly in the wet season (Dec-May) with 300+ mm monthly. Dry season sees minimal rain under 50 mm. Extremes include highs up to 38°C (100°F) and rare colds to 15°C (59°F). These patterns influence commuting and outdoor classes at Universidad Técnica de Cotopaxi. Seasonal Weather Patterns at Universidad Técnica de Cotopaxi
Guayaquil's wet season (Dec-May) brings frequent heavy rains, averaging 250 mm monthly, increasing flood risks and requiring umbrellas or rain gear. Dry season (Jun-Nov) offers clearer skies with temperatures steady at 30°C (86°F) highs. Universidad Técnica de Cotopaxi may adjust schedules for extreme rain. Environmental Factors in Guayaquil
At sea level (5m altitude), Guayaquil has no high-elevation issues but faces geology from the Andean foothills, prone to minor tremors. Air quality is moderate (AQI 60-100), affected by traffic and port emissions, potentially causing respiratory concerns. Natural Hazards and Safety at Universidad Técnica de Cotopaxi
Common risks include seasonal floods from El Niño rains, occasional earthquakes (Ecuador seismic zone), and rare tropical storms. Droughts are minimal. Universidad Técnica de Cotopaxi has emergency protocols, including alerts and evacuation drills.
